Abstract:
A method and a composition for suppressing and eliminating dust particulate. The composition includes an aqueous gelling solution, and a proppant particulate. The aqueous gelling solution and the proppant particulate are combined to create a mixture. The aqueous gelling solution and the proppant particulate may be combined using at least one of composition spraying the aqueous gelling solution, mist spraying the aqueous gelling solution, and atomized spraying aqueous gelling solution. The mixture may include around 0.1 weight percent to 5 weight percent w/v of the aqueous gelling solution. The gelling agent may include a suitable viscosifying polymer. The suitable viscosifying polymer may include at least one of natural polymers, derivatives of natural polymers, synthetic polymers, biopolymers, and any combination thereof, guar, xanthan, diutan, scleroglucan, high-molecular weight polysaccharides, any derivative thereof, and any combination thereof, hydropropyl guar (HPG), carboxymethyl guar (CMG), and carboxymethylhydroxypropyl guar (CMHPG).
